No one can tell me why and nothing works.
11 years ago i noticed some thinning. I ignored it thought it was from stress. 4 years ago i was diagnosed with thyroid cancer and had my thyroid removed. By this time my thinning was very significant. But all my hormone levels showed to be normal. Dermatologist says I have non scarring but no known cause. Its not hereditary. And doesn't improve with minoxidil or hair lasers or oils. I try to use hair toppers to cover but my scalp is very sensitive and they hurt my head. So I wear a beanie all year round and its very depressing. I dont know what else to do. I've tried topix too but that stuff gets everywhere and makes my head itch.
